Wooden is applied mostly for indoor sculpture, for It's not as tough or strong as stone; alterations of humidity and temperature might induce it to split, and it is subject matter to attack by insects and fungus. The grain of wood is among its most tasty options, offering assortment of pattern and texture to its surfaces. Its colors, far too, are refined and different. In general, wood has a heat that stone doesn't have, nonetheless it lacks The huge dignity and weight of stone.

Molding and casting: Sculptors can produce copies of their function by means of molding and casting. They use plaster, clay, gelatin, or silicone to produce a mildew in the sculpture, then they fill the mildew with moist clay, plaster, or Yet another content to reproduce it.
